Microsoft Visual Studio 2022 Community Offline | Installer
The Visual Studio 2022 Community offline installer is a powerful tool for IT administrators, educators, and developers who need reliable, repeatable, internet-free installation. While the initial download requires significant bandwidth and storage, the benefits in controlled environments outweigh the costs. Microsoft provides straightforward command-line tooling to generate and maintain these layouts, making it a practical solution for offline deployment scenarios.
The installer will download all required files to the specified folder. This may take a considerable amount of time. Phase 2: Transfer and Install on the Target Machine
Microsoft.VisualStudio.Workload.NativeDesktop
Install once from a high-speed connection, then deploy locally without waiting for multi-gigabyte downloads. microsoft visual studio 2022 community offline installer
folder to the offline machine using a USB drive or network share. Install on the Offline Machine
Save the file, which will be named , to a temporary folder on a machine with a reliable internet connection. Step 2: Create a Local Layout Folder
The standard "bootstrapper" file you download from the Microsoft website is tiny—usually just a few megabytes. When you run it, it downloads the necessary components in real-time. While this ensures you get the latest updates, it has drawbacks: The Visual Studio 2022 Community offline installer is
Use --list or Microsoft documentation for workload IDs.
While the installation is offline, requires you to sign in within 30 days to keep the product activated. If your machine is permanently offline, you may need a Professional or Enterprise license, which supports offline product key activation.
If the offline machine has never been online, it might lack updated root certificates. Navigate to the certificates subfolder inside your layout directory. Right-click and install each certificate before running the main installer. The installer will download all required files to
On the client machine, point the installer to your updated network layout:
This option downloads only the specific components required for your specific field of development (e.g., desktop development, web development, or game design). It drastically reduces the final folder size. Step 3: Run the Command to Create the Layout